#bd9e48 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#bd9e48 is composed of 74.1% red, 62%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 16.4% magenta, 61.9%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 44.1 degrees, a saturation of 47% and a lightness of 51.2%. #bd9e48 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ff90 with #7b3d00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

Shades and Tints of #bd9e48

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040402 is the darkest color, while #fbfaf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#bd9e48

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#848381 is the less saturated color, while #f6b90f is the most saturated one.
